Output 408898a279bdf96c7cfec61aff69ee28844ce5628d00d5f88eedebef48d143d9:4

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e0a24da51d20afcb59518086415c9cbe2c9190ab060c88095787c3e8cc307975
address
bc1puz3ymfgayzhukk23szryzhyuhckfry9tqcxgsz2hslp73nps096s2kptzg
transaction
408898a279bdf96c7cfec61aff69ee28844ce5628d00d5f88eedebef48d143d9
spent
true